What is an Patio Gas Bottle?

A patio gas bottle is a form of LPG (liquefied petroleum gas) cylinder that is specifically designed for use with outdoor appliances such as barbecues and heaters for patios. It's available in green bottles of up to 13kg, and can fit the standard 27mm clip-on regulator.

cheap patio gas gas is different to propane in that it's a particular brand of LPG that has been refined specifically for outdoor use. It can be propane or butane. Both are equally effective and can be used to power outdoor appliances such as barbecues and patio heaters. However propane is more suitable for colder temperatures.

All of our patio gas bottles come with a built in Gas Trac indicator so that you can quickly tell when the gas is low, and are also compatible with a large range of BBQ's and outdoor heating equipment. If you own a BBQ that has only two or three burners and you want to use our gas patio bottle of 5kg is the ideal. It will last for a long time before it needs to be refilled.

If you own a huge BBQ with four burners or more or are planning to purchase one in the future we suggest our gas bottle for your patio of 13kg. This bottle isn't just suitable for BBQs, but will also provide you with enough gas to power your patio heater during long summer evenings.

What is a Patio Gas Cylinder?

It is sometimes confusing to use the term "porch gas" because it could refer to either propane or butane. Patio gas is a distinct kind of LPG that is used for outdoor appliances such as barbeques and heating sources for patios. The gas cylinders have a specific size and type, and should only be used with these appliances. They come with a specific connector and valve that will not fit regular BBQ gas bottles or other appliances without the conversion kit.

The majority of leisure equipment comes with an adjustable regulator that lowers the pressure when the gas is moved from the bottle into the appliance. The regulators are connected to heads of the cylinders using clips or screws depending on the size and type of bottle (see below for further information). Propane and butane are two types of LPG However, they have different boiling points, which means they cannot be interchanged unless you also switch the gas regulators on your appliance.

All Calor propane and butane gas bottles have a built-in Gas Trac indicator that lets you know when it's time to change your cylinder. The test date of your cylinder is located on one of the side collars. It is stamped with two numbers and a letter. The letter signifies the quarter during which the test is due. (A for the first one, B for the second and then on.) The number indicates the year.

A Patio gas cylinder has an attractive green lid and is designed to be used with a 27mm clip on regulator. It can be used to cook with butane indoor portable heaters, as well as other appliances that work with propane or butane.

It is crucial to know the distinction between propane and butane as you'll frequently see them sold in similar-looking bottles. Butane is available in blue cylinders, and is perfect for camping, single-burner cooking appliances and indoor portable heating. Propane is, on the other hand is available in green cylinders and is used to power outdoor appliances like barbecues and heating for patios.

Both kinds of gas are available in a vast range of sizes from 3.9kg all the way to 47kg. This range includes both 'clip-on and screw in' propane cylinders. The cylinders with a 'clip on' are connected to the barbecue by pushing them onto the propane regulator. Screw in propane bottles require you to screw into the correct position.

13kg Patio Gas Bottle

The 13kg patio bottle is great for barbecues as it supplies the energy needed to power small and medium barbecues (3 burners minimum) pizza ovens, and chimeneas. It's also the preferred choice for camping, as well as fuelling cooking and heating appliances in touring and static caravans. It can also be used on narrow boats and catering vans.

Gas bottles for patio use are basically large propane gas cylinders. The regulator on the bottle transforms liquid propane into gas that can be used in barbecues. The appropriate type of regulator must be installed on the barbecue to reach the desired pressure. To protect yourself from gas leaks, the regulator needs to be removed from the appliance and the gas bottle should be kept in a safe place.
